About the Role

Monarch Communities, a premier provider of quality senior living, is seeking a Chef to join our team! The Chef will assist the Executive Chef in all phases of meal preparation, prepare salad bar offerings, desserts, and bakery items, and maintain the highest standards of sanitation and safety practices in all phases of kitchen operation, food preparation, and storage.

Responsibilities

  • Assist the Executive Chef in all phases of meal preparation.
  • Prepare salad bar offerings, desserts, and bakery items.
  • Maintain the highest standards of sanitation and safety practices in all phases of kitchen operation, food preparation, and storage.
  • Maintain a working knowledge of culinary methods as related to ingredient preparation and recipe execution.
  • Assist Executive Chef with meal preparation as assigned.
  • May assist in procurement of food inventory and supplies.
  • Properly label and store food items in accordance with safe storage standards.
  • Understand the operation and maintenance of kitchen equipment (food processor, dishwasher, convection oven, etc.).
  • Maintain a clean and sanitary work environment, including floors.
  • Responsible for creation and preparation of baked food items, breads, desserts, etc.
  • Perform scheduled cleaning of equipment and work according to schedule as planned by the Executive Chef.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• ServSafe certification
  • Prior customer service or hospitality experience preferred
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to multitask and remain calm under pressure

Work Type

  • Part Time
  • Regular Part Time - Scheduled less Than 30 at Least 22.5 Per Week

Education Level

  • High school diploma or equivalent

Salary/Compensations

  • USD 22 - USD 24 - hourly
